Basically, ICF enables the contractor to construct a high-quality cast-in-place concrete wall by forming the wall with permanently installed insulation instead of the more conventional wood or steel removable formwork. Insulated Concrete Forms (ICFs) are formwork for concrete that stays in place as permanent building insulation for energy-efficient, cast-in-place, reinforced concrete walls, floors, and roofs.. One problem with ICF construction is that it's impossible to visually inspect the quality of the pour, making voids large & small are possible to miss prior to installing the finish wall, and cracks in the wall aren't always visible on the above-grade exterior until the problem is pretty big. The truth is, an increasing percentage of ICF construction is above-grade, and factoring in the array of available wall core thicknesses and means of exterior finish systems that can be used with ICFs, there is typically no height limitation to an ICF building within appropriate building uses and setback constraints in the USA and Canada.
